如何设置网络监控的SSL/TLS加密?
随着互联网技术的飞速发展,网络安全问题日益凸显。SSL/TLS加密作为一种重要的网络安全技术,被广泛应用于各种网络应用中。为了确保网络数据的安全传输,设置网络监控的SSL/TLS加密变得尤为重要。本文将详细介绍如何设置网络监控的SSL/TLS加密,帮助您更好地保障网络安全。
一、了解SSL/TLS加密
SSL(Secure Sockets Layer)和TLS(Transport Layer Security)都是一种网络安全的协议,用于在客户端和服务器之间建立加密连接,确保数据传输的安全性。SSL/TLS加密通过以下步骤实现:
- 握手阶段:客户端与服务器之间建立连接,协商加密算法、密钥交换方式等安全参数。
- 加密阶段:客户端和服务器使用协商好的加密算法和密钥进行数据传输,确保数据在传输过程中的安全性。
- 结束阶段:连接结束后,双方销毁密钥,确保后续通信的安全性。
二、设置网络监控的SSL/TLS加密
- 选择合适的SSL/TLS版本
为了提高安全性,建议选择最新的SSL/TLS版本。目前,TLS 1.3是最新版本,具有更高的安全性能。您可以通过以下步骤选择合适的SSL/TLS版本:
- 检查服务器支持:确保您的服务器支持TLS 1.3版本。
- 更新客户端:确保您的客户端(如浏览器、邮件客户端等)支持TLS 1.3版本。
- 配置SSL/TLS证书
SSL/TLS证书是建立加密连接的关键。以下步骤可帮助您配置SSL/TLS证书:
- 申请证书:您可以通过CA(Certificate Authority,证书颁发机构)申请SSL/TLS证书。
- 导入证书:将证书导入到您的服务器上。
- 配置证书:在服务器上配置证书,确保服务器能够正确使用证书。
- 优化SSL/TLS配置
以下是一些优化SSL/TLS配置的建议:
- 禁用过时的加密算法:禁用已知的漏洞算法,如DES、3DES等。
- 启用强加密算法:选择具有更高安全性能的加密算法,如ECDHE-RSA-AES256-GCM-SHA384。
- 优化密钥交换方式:选择具有更高安全性能的密钥交换方式,如ECDHE。
- 监控SSL/TLS加密
为了确保SSL/TLS加密的有效性,您需要定期监控以下指标:
- 证书有效期:确保证书在有效期内。
- 连接成功率:确保加密连接的成功率。
- 加密算法使用情况:确保使用的加密算法符合安全要求。
三、案例分析
以下是一个实际案例,说明如何设置网络监控的SSL/TLS加密:
案例背景:某企业使用HTTPS协议进行数据传输,但发现部分用户无法正常访问。
解决方案:
- 检查服务器配置:发现服务器配置的SSL/TLS版本过低,导致部分用户无法访问。
- 更新SSL/TLS版本:将服务器配置的SSL/TLS版本更新为TLS 1.3。
- 优化加密算法:将加密算法优化为ECDHE-RSA-AES256-GCM-SHA384。
- 监控加密连接:定期监控加密连接的成功率和证书有效期。
通过以上步骤,企业成功解决了用户无法访问的问题,并提高了网络数据传输的安全性。
总之,设置网络监控的SSL/TLS加密是保障网络安全的重要措施。通过了解SSL/TLS加密、配置SSL/TLS证书、优化SSL/TLS配置和监控SSL/TLS加密,您可以更好地保障网络安全。
猜你喜欢:业务性能指标